Stop investing in new nuclear power in the UK

Petition Details

The waste from nuclear energy is a liability for future generations. An accident or terrorist attack at nuclear sites could be catastrophic. New technology means there are green alternatives which we believe are superior to nuclear power. The Government should stop investing in new nuclear power.

Additional Information

Since new technological developments have improved green power generation, we believe the Government should redirect investment in nuclear energy to wind turbines onshore & off, solar power and tidal powered green energies.

It is quicker to produce, still creates jobs if we manufacture in the UK and does not leave a problem for the next generations to dispose of dangerous waste.

Some members of the public complain about the look and impact of onshore wind farms in their county, but we believe these are preferable to new nuclear power stations.
